What Exactly Is a Virtual Assistant?

A virtual assistant (VA) is someone who provides support services to businesses or individuals from a remote location. The term encompasses both human assistants working remotely and digital tools designed to automate tasks through software.

Human Virtual Assistants

These are real people who work remotely to handle various administrative, technical, or creative tasks. They typically operate as independent contractors or through agencies, providing services on an hourly, part-time, or project basis.

Digital Virtual Assistants

These are software-based helpers that use artificial intelligence to perform tasks through voice or text commands. Think Siri, Alexa, or Google Assistant, but potentially with more specialized business capabilities.

Common Tasks Handled by Virtual Assistants

Virtual assistants typically handle a range of administrative and operational tasks that don't require physical presence:

  • Email management and correspondence
  • Calendar scheduling and appointment setting
  • Data entry and basic bookkeeping
  • Travel arrangements
  • Phone calls and customer service
  • Social media management
  • Research and information gathering
  • Basic content creation
